Palak Gupta, an industrial designer from Georgia Tech, is passionate about co-designing products that bring joy and positive impact. She actively listens to users to ensure her designs matter. Palak served as the production director at TEDx Georgia Tech and guided design enthusiasts through the Design Club. She worked as an industrial designer at Panasonic and Voltas, earning a design registration. Her project, FidBR, funded by Create-X, helps parents manage children’s screen time through play. She shared insights at a design panel with Cognizant and presented on sustainability at Harmonic Design. She connects with the community through the Service Design Network.
